Partager via


Paramètres TinyTag dynamiques

Un ID TinyTag est associé à diverses données statiques dans la base de données Xandr. Certains des paramètres associés à TinyTag peuvent être ajoutés ou remplacés dynamiquement au moment de la demande TinyTag ou de l’appel publicitaire.

L’identification par ID ou par membre et code (voir Appel de TinyTags via des codes au lieu de l’ID ci-dessous) sont des paramètres obligatoires dans un TinyTag. La taille est également requise si elle n’a pas été pré-associée à l’ID TinyTag. Tous les autres paramètres sont facultatifs.

Paramètres

Paramètre Description Exemple
id ID généré par le service Tinytag. id=131
member Au lieu de l’ID, un TinyTag peut être référencé par l’ID de membre et « inv_code ». member=48
cb Cachebuster.
inv_code Identique à « code » du service TinyTag. Peut être utilisé pour référencer un TinyTag avec « membre ». inv_code=testcase
default_tag_id Créé via le service membre, il s’agit de l’ID par défaut si le membre est connu, mais que le « inv_code » ne l’est pas. Ce paramètre peut également être utilisé pour remplacer une default_tag_id prédéfinie. default_tag_id=456
pubclick URL fournie par l’éditeur pour le suivi des clics tiers.
Remarque : Si vous incluez le pubclick paramètre, il doit s’agir du dernier paramètre de la chaîne. Tous les paramètres ajoutés ci-dessous pubclick empêchent le créateur de cliquer correctement.
pubclick=https%3A//click.adserver.com
debug Utilisé pour exécuter une impression de débogage.
Remarque : Dans une impression de débogage, les demandes de notification ne sont pas envoyées et userdata_json les commandes ne sont pas exécutées.
debug=1
test Utilisé pour exécuter une enchère de test. Xandr ne transactione pas l’impression dans une enchère de test et rien n’est consigné. Le contenu de la publicité est également ignoré. test=1
debug_node Utilisé sur une impression de débogage pour diriger la demande d’offre vers un soumissionnaire spécifique instance. Définissez debug_node sur l’ID du instance du soumissionnaire du service d’instance du soumissionnaire. debug_node=25
size Obligatoire s’il n’est pas déjà défini sur le TinyTag. Ce paramètre ne remplace PAS un format de taille prédéfini ; widthXheight. 300x250
referrer URL de la page contenant le TinyTag.
Remarque : Si Xandr détecte que cette URL fausse l’inventaire (c’est-à-dire qu’il ne s’agit pas de l’URL réelle de l’impression), nous pouvons désactiver cette fonctionnalité pour le TinyTag. Pour plus d’informations sur les pratiques de vente interdites, consultez Partie des stratégies de service.
https%3A//mysite.com
age Peut passer l’âge numérique, l’année de naissance ou la plage d’âge avec trait d’union. 56, 1974, or 25-35
gender Valeurs possibles : m, f pour mâle, femelle m
reserve Prix de réserve pour cet inventaire. Ce paramètre remplacera un prix prédéfini. 5.00
qsdata (API de plateforme de Xandr uniquement) Données arbitraires qui seront transmises textuellement au soumissionnaire (facultatif) yourdatahere
flash Le flash est-il installé par l’utilisateur ? Valeurs possibles : 1 ou 0. 1
within_iframe Cette annonce sera-t-elle jamais servie à l’intérieur d’un iframe ? Valeurs possibles : 1 ou 0. 1
debug_timeout Durée maximale (en millisecondes) pendant laquelle le bus d’impression attend les réponses aux enchères après l’envoi de la demande d’offre. Les soumissionnaires qui ne répondent pas dans la fenêtre de délai d’expiration recevront une erreur « La connexion a été limitée, a échoué ou a expiré ». La valeur utilisée en production (et par défaut dans l’environnement de sable) est de 2 000 ms, mais peut être remplacée dans l’environnement de sable en transmettant une valeur différente pour le délai d’expiration.
Remarque : Le remplacement du délai d’expiration est utilisé uniquement lors de l’exécution d’une impression de débogage.
timeout=100
position Position de la balise sur la page. Valeurs possibles : « au-dessus » (au-dessus du pli) ou « en dessous ». position=above
truncate_ip Si 1 ou true, le dernier octet de l’adresse IP de l’utilisateur sera tronqué dans la demande d’enchère. Utilisez cet indicateur pour les balises publicitaires dans les juridictions où l’adresse IP est considérée comme des informations d’identification personnelle. (L’adresse IP complète continuera d’être utilisée à des fins opérationnelles et de sécurité, bien sûr.) Pour plus d’informations sur la confidentialité et la plateforme de Xandr, consultez Archive 2022 - Confidentialité et plateforme Xandr. truncate_ip=1
prevent_rtb Indique si le RTB non transactionné doit être bloqué. Valeurs possibles :
0: utilisez les paramètres de l’API de plateforme de Xandr.
1: tous les rtb sont bloqués et les paramètres de l’API de plateforme de Xandr sont ignorés.
Si et prevent_deals ont 1la valeur prevent_rtb , aucune demande d’offre n’est envoyée.
prevent_rtb=1
prevent_deals Indique si toutes les transactions doivent être bloquées. Valeurs possibles :
- 0: Utiliser les paramètres de l’API de plateforme de Xandr
- 1: toutes les transactions sont bloquées et les paramètres de l’API de plateforme de Xandr sont ignorés.
Si et prevent_rtb prevent_deals sont définis sur 1, aucune demande d’offre n’est envoyée.
prevent_deals=0
gdpr Indique si les réglementations RGPD ou les logiques TCF sont appliquées, ou si un utilisateur se trouve dans un pays concerné par le RGPD (pays de l’EEE). 1 if yes, 0 if no.
gdpr_consent Indique la chaîne de consentement RGPD IAB réelle. Cela implique quels fournisseurs TCF sont autorisés à traiter les données personnelles et dans quelles conditions. CO2jXwtO2jXwtB7AAAENAtC4AIAAAEJAAAqIAQAAAAAEAIAAAAACAAA.YAAAAAAAAAA
gpp Indique la chaîne de consentement réelle du GPP IAB. Cela implique quels fournisseurs sont autorisés à traiter les données personnelles et dans quelles conditions. gpp=DBACNYA~CPXxRfAPXxRfAAfKABENB-CgAAAAAAAAAAYgAAAAAAAA~1YNN
gpp_sid Indique quelle(s) réglementation(s) ou logique(s) GPP doivent être appliquées, ou si un utilisateur se trouve dans un pays (pays de l’EEE) avec un cadre qui fait partie du GPP. gpp_sid=6,7

Exemple d’utilisation

TinyTag utilisant uniquement l’ID :

https://ib.adnxs.com/tt?id=156

TinyTag transmettant des informations supplémentaires : Données dynamiques : age=29, gender=male

https://ib.adnxs.com/tt?id=156&age=29&gender=male

TinyTag avec données de chaîne de requête

Remarque

Si vous passez des variables querystring dans le paramètre qsdata, veillez à encoder la chaîne de données comme illustré ici.

likes=cheese

puid=322DD1BF-B288-4271-BCA4

https://ib.adnxs.com/tt?id=156&qsdata=likes%3Dcheese%26puid%3D322DD1BF-B288-4271-BCA4

Appel de TinyTags via des codes au lieu de l’ID

Dans les situations où un TinyTag ne peut pas être appelé via l’ID TinyTag, vous pouvez appeler un TinyTag par un champ défini par un membre appelé « inv_code ». Ce code alphanumérique est associé au service TinyTag.

Exemple d’appel de code TinyTag :

https://ib.adnxs.com/tt?member=1&inv_code=abcdef

TinyTag à l’aide du RGPD :

https://ib.adnxs.com/getuid?
https://somedomain.com&gdpr=1&uid=$UID&gpdr_consent=CO2jXwtO2jXwtB7AAAENAtC4AIAAAEJAAAqIAQAAAAAEAIAAAAACAAA.YAAAAAAAAAA